It's been a bit mad lately...
There has been a lot happening at AFC Phoenix in recent weeks and it's not really been discussed due to the sheer amount of work manager Gareth Phoenix has put in since winning their division (unbeaten) just four weeks ago. We managed to catch a rare few minutes with the Englishman post match after his team kept their second Division 3e clean sheet of the new season...

Phoenix: I'm not sure where to start really. The past 4 weeks have been long and hard but now we're here they seem to have gone In the blink of an eye!

The best place to start is probably the name change and rebrand I guess. As soon as the season finished we were always going to revert back to our original name of AFC Phoenix due to the Gentlemens Practice sponsorship deal coming to an end due to their sad closure after COVID. We last sported the AFCP branding back in July 2015 for over five years prior to the GP deal.

I'd like to place on record my thanks to Gentlemens Practice for the 7 years they helped fund us. During that time we managed to win Xpert International incredibly at our first attempt. However that still remains our only silverwear although a decent last 16 exit showing in our first XCL and some incredibly unlucky cup runs falling short of a final by just one penalty kick in a shoot out.

That time has set some foundations and history that we now want to build on so ironically we move forward by moving back to our "home town" name.

So after sorting all that obviously there had to be an unforeseen transfer merry-go-round after the Change Report. Bloody hell could I have done without that but we had to be patient and scout the right people whilst selling the right players too. At the end of it me and my team are delighted at our business with a couple of young players to help uphold the future in Caj and Mason but being able to bring in Bill Pugh also who we have no doubt will hit the ground running as we try to navigate a very tough division is just great for the club.

These situations weren't the hardest job I have to stay on top of though. My main job (to me) is keeping this squad grounded and focused.

After we lost in the cup last season (our only loss in the last 28 games I should add) we needed to ensure it didn't affect them and then the league form suffer also. In fact they picked me up after that loss and have won all 12 games since. The "Bouncebackability" of these boys keeps surprising me. I say boys, we're still a young team but they've played like experienced men in so many games.

This new season comes with new challenges as always and we find ourselves in a very tough division 3e with a lot of strong teams. We've started well with two wins and no goals conceded but it's work as usual as we only focus on one game at a time.

We're not invincible and we'll lose games this season. It's about the manner of those losses, ensuring we give our best every single game and maintaining that "Bouncebackability" mentality.
